Product Description
2014's Special Release of Brora is closer in style to the 2012 bottling rather than the earthier 2013. Aged in a combination of refill American and European oak, this has the classic Brora waxiness.

Tasting Notes
Tasting Notes by Rocky
Nose
Rich and sweet notes of vanilla, stewed fruits and a hint of smoke.
Palate
Waxy texture with black tea, vanilla and smoke. Elegant yet complex, water brings out some tropical fruit.
Finish
Long with vanilla at the front.
